Output 95b0695a7460c592933b97b425c6d1e1d2461829d34cf4a6bdb7d84107fc2642:20

value
649025
script pubkey
OP_0 OP_PUSHBYTES_20 98d3a3f5ba59b4c944c4552f6816f0466652216b
address
bc1qnrf68ad6tx6vj3xy25hks9hsgen9ygttgr4stk
transaction
95b0695a7460c592933b97b425c6d1e1d2461829d34cf4a6bdb7d84107fc2642
spent
true